Planning Specialist II
Summary: The main function of the purchasing/ planning specialist is to provide data and analytical support to the planning team. This position will be responsible for utilizing SAP and Excel to create vendor forecasts, compiling data to understand supply gaps, working with vendors and planners to ensure orders are confirmed, and conduct ad hoc analysis to support informed decision-making.
Job Responsibilities:
· Develop and maintain vendor forecasts using SAP and Excel
· Compile and analyze data to identify and quantify potential supply gaps
· Monitor open orders and proactively follow up on confirmations, changes, or delays
· Support resolution of supply constraints by coordinating across procurement, planning, and supplier partners
· Conduct ad hoc analyses to support data-driven decision-making and continuous improvement initiatives
· Support invoice analysis and resolution
Skills:
· Verbal and written communication skills, attention to detail
· Experience with MS Office, strong MS Excel skills necessary
· Ability to analyze supply plans and clearly articulate gaps
· SAP experience preferred
Education/Experience
· Bachelor’s degree in business field
· 1-2 years planning or procurement experience required
